Summary

Aptask Global Workforce (AGW) is seeking a QC Systems Specialist for a Remote position with a Global Biotechnology Company located in Thousand Oaks, CA. This is a 24+ month contract opportunity.

This specialist role supports site business process owners, templators, and end-users of the Quality Control (QC) Electronic Lab Notebook (ELN) and consumable management systems. The candidate will be responsible for supporting and troubleshooting issues across seven of the client's QC organizations, focusing on templating, template qualification, and system usage.

Responsibilities:
  • Support templating, template qualification, and use of ELN and consumable management systems
  • Troubleshoot system issues and collaborate with the technology function for timely resolution
  • Review and approve system user access, periodic reviews, and annual audit trail reviews
  • Author SOP revisions related to the supported systems
  • Review system documentation for changes, including system descriptions, design specifications, and data integrity assessments
  • Provide input to deviations and guidance on appropriate corrective/preventative actions
  • Drive alignment and standardization across the QC network
  • Lead biweekly network meetings and provide audit support
  • Coordinate system downtime windows and develop queries/reports

Requirements:
  • Bachelor's degree and a minimum of 5 years of experience in QC
  • Experience as a business process owner
  • Ability to problem solve and troubleshoot system issues
  • Ability to work independently and deliver right-first-time results
  • Knowledge of data integrity requirements for QC systems
  • Strong, clear, and concise communication skills
  • Document authoring and review capabilities

Desired skills:
  • Experience in Biovia SmartLab and CIMS
  • Knowledge of SQL and Tableau
  • Audit support experience
